From 03ec19e1313fa30b8039f3ce507efb11242dd3ec Mon Sep 17 00:00:00 2001
From: admin <344137771@qq.com>
Date: Wed, 28 Jan 2026 17:28:08 +0800
Subject: [PATCH] 1
---
src/page/trading/buy.vue | 10 ++++++++++
1 files changed, 10 insertions(+), 0 deletions(-)
diff --git a/src/page/trading/buy.vue b/src/page/trading/buy.vue
index 3f24ce9..baf40b9 100644
--- a/src/page/trading/buy.vue
+++ b/src/page/trading/buy.vue
@@ -333,6 +333,16 @@
}
}
},
+ // 路由守卫 - 离开页面时清除 alert
+ beforeRouteLeave(to, from, next) {
+ // 如果 alert 正在显示,清除它
+ if (this.$store.state.elAlertShow) {
+ this.$store.commit("elAlertShow", {
+ elAlertShow: false
+ });
+ }
+ next();
+ },
methods: {
async queryStockConfig() {
let data = await api.queryStockConfig();
--
Gitblit v1.9.3